The Importance Of Art Insurance: Protecting Your Investments

Investing in art can be a lucrative and rewarding endeavor. Whether you collect fine art, antiques, or other valuable pieces, it is important to protect your investments through art insurance. Art insurance provides coverage in case of theft, damage, or loss of your prized possessions. Without proper insurance, you could face devastating financial losses and emotional distress if something were to happen to your art collection.

Art insurance is a specialized type of insurance that is designed to protect works of art and collectibles. These policies can cover a wide range of items, including paintings, sculptures, antiques, and other valuable pieces. Art insurance provides coverage for a variety of risks, such as theft, fire, vandalism, and natural disasters. In some cases, it can even cover damage caused by improper handling or transportation.

One of the main reasons why art insurance is essential for art collectors is the high value of art pieces. Art can be incredibly valuable, with some pieces fetching millions of dollars at auction. If your art collection were to be damaged or stolen, the financial losses could be substantial. Art insurance provides coverage for the full value of your art collection, ensuring that you can recover financially if something were to happen to your precious possessions.

Another important reason to invest in art insurance is the emotional attachment that many art collectors have to their pieces. Art can hold sentimental value and emotional significance, making it even more devastating if something were to happen to it. Having art insurance can provide peace of mind knowing that your investments are protected and that you will be financially compensated in the event of a loss.

When it comes to selecting art insurance, there are several factors to consider. It is important to choose a policy that provides comprehensive coverage for your art collection. This includes coverage for a wide range of risks, such as theft, fire, vandalism, and natural disasters. Additionally, you should consider the value of your art collection and make sure that your policy provides coverage for its full value.

Another important factor to consider when selecting art insurance is the reputation and experience of the insurance provider. Look for an insurance company that specializes in art insurance and has a proven track record of providing quality coverage and excellent customer service. It is important to work with an insurance provider that understands the unique risks associated with art and can tailor a policy to meet your specific needs.

In addition to selecting the right art insurance policy, it is also important to properly document and appraise your art collection. This includes keeping detailed records of each piece in your collection, including photographs, descriptions, and appraisals. Having thorough documentation can help expedite the claims process in case of a loss and ensure that you receive the full value of your art collection.
